I'm running 15" in the winter on my LS. However, the SS has larger front rotors that I doubt would clear the wheel (it's already tight on the LS/LT). Also, I used my emergency spare in the front already and it fits; another indication that SS would have issues with 15" wheels, if they warn about this.

The 15" black steel rims suggested for winter tires from Tirerack DO NOT fit! I got mine today, they will not clear the stock front brake caliper on the SS.
